Bolivar County sits in the heart of the Mississippi Delta, where a majority African American population and persistent rural poverty have produced some of the most reliably Democratic presidential margins in the state for decades.
Across the recorded series it reached a Democratic high of 91.6 points in 1936 and a Republican high of 73.0 points in 1964. Between 2020 and 2024 the county moved 7.1 points toward the Republican candidate; the 2024 margin was 23.7 points.
A population of 29,534, a 31% non-Hispanic-white share, and a median household income of $39,585 describe the county. The county's voting pattern over the last decade is most similar to that of Coahoma County and Leflore County.
